1. Katie is bowling. She starts with the ball in her right hand and her arm as far back as it will go. She swings the ball forward, applying a force of 78 Newtons the whole time. When her hand has traveled through a path of 0.9 meters, she releases the ball, and it rolls down the lane.

How much work is involved in this example?
A.0 N⋅m
B.70.2 N⋅m
C.94 N⋅m
D.Andy pushes a desk across the floor.

To calculate the work involved in this example, we need to use the formula:

Work = Force x Distance

Given that the force applied is 78 Newtons and the distance traveled is 0.9 meters, we can calculate the work involved as:

Work = 78 N x 0.9 m
Work = 70.2 N⋅m

So, the correct answer is B. 70.2 N⋅m.
